Call for Participants: “Youth Exchange Leadership Skills”

3/12/2018

Comments

 
Picture
Name: “Youth Exchange Leadership Skills”
Dates: 20-25 January 2019
Type: Erasmus+ (KA1 – Youth Mobility) Training Course 
Participants needed: 1 participant
Age: 18+
Location: Pragelato, Italy 
Costs: Travel costs covered up to a limit of €275 (per activity). Food and accommodation 100% free. Membership fee of 5 EUR for non-members. Participation fee Malta - €10.
Host Organisation: Madiba SCS
Countries Participating: Greece, Ireland, Latvia, Malta, Romania, Sweden, UK and Italy
Sending Organisation: Malta UNESCO Youth Association

Project Description:
‘Youth Exchange Leadership Skills’ seeks to explore the factors that define quality in group leadership within Youth Exchanges before, during and after stages of a youth exchange project and develop participants’ competencies in realising such projects and leading groups to Youth Exchanges. The aim of the project is to create a long term, substantial educational experience for youth exchange group leaders towards the maximization of learning and minimization of risk for the young people they will be leading in the future, and through these, to increase the recognition of their role as learning facilitators/educators.
